可以使用QSqlQuery类的exec()方法执行SQL语句来实现数据库的降序排列。

以下是一个示例代码:

#include <QtSql>

int main()
{
    QSqlDatabase db = QSqlDatabase::addDatabase("QSQLITE");
    db.setDatabaseName("path_to_database_file");
    
    if (!db.open()) {
        qDebug() << "Failed to open database!";
        return -1;
    }
    
    QSqlQuery query;
    query.exec("SELECT * FROM table_name ORDER BY column_name DESC");
    
    while (query.next()) {
        // 处理查询结果
    }
    
    db.close();
    
    return 0;
}

在上述代码中,table_name是要查询的表名,column_name是要按照降序排列的列名。使用ORDER BY column_name DESC来实现降序排列。

注意,这只是一个简单的示例代码,实际使用时需要根据具体情况修改数据库文件路径、表名和列名等信息。

Qt中数据库降序排列

原文地址: https://www.cveoy.top/t/topic/iy6D 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录